Abstract
The present invention provides a kind of HDD encrypted firmwares update method, device and electronic equipment.The USB storage device for being stored with redaction HDD encrypted firmwares is connected with any one USB port of the electronic equipment of HDD encrypted firmwares to be updated, and methods described includes:The electronic equipment is opened, into BIOS interfaces, the HDD encrypted firmwares programming function is opened at the BIOS interfaces;The electronic equipment is restarted, into DOS interfaces, at the DOS interfaces, by the redaction HDD encrypted firmwares programming in the USB storage device to the electronic equipment.The present invention can improve the operating efficiency of HDD encrypted firmwares renewal.

Background technology
In some concerning security matters projects, to ensure information security, it is necessary to HDD (Hard Disk Drive, hard disk to using
Driver) it is encrypted, while encrypted firmware needs to regularly update.
At present, HDD encrypted firmwares update method is mainly carried out in the following manner:
USB flash disk containing redaction firmware is inserted to some USB port of the computer of HDD encrypted firmwares to be updated, definition
The USB port is encrypted firmware more new interface, and firmware programming is encrypted by third party's flashburn tools, calculating is restarted after programming is complete
Machine, then the USB port is redefined as to the USB port of general function.
During the present invention is realized, inventor has found following technical problem in the prior art at least be present:
During each firmware renewal, USB port will be configured, influence operating efficiency.

Embodiment
To make the purpose, technical scheme and advantage of the embodiment of the present invention clearer, below in conjunction with the embodiment of the present invention
In accompanying drawing, the technical scheme in the embodiment of the present invention is clearly and completely described, it is clear that described embodiment is only
Only it is part of the embodiment of the present invention, rather than whole embodiments.Based on the embodiment in the present invention, ordinary skill
The every other embodiment that personnel are obtained under the premise of creative work is not made, belongs to the scope of protection of the invention.
The embodiment of the present invention provides a kind of HDD encrypted firmwares update method, is stored with the USB of redaction HDD encrypted firmwares
Storage device is connected with any one USB port of the electronic equipment of HDD encrypted firmwares to be updated, as shown in figure 1, methods described bag
Include:
S11, after electronic equipment unlatching, the BIOS enabled instructions that send of user are received, into BIOS interfaces;
S12, the HDD encrypted firmware programming function open commands that are sent at the BIOS interfaces of user are received, described in unlatching
HDD encrypted firmware programming functions;
S13, after the electronic equipment is restarted, the DOS enabled instructions that send of user are received, into DOS interfaces;
S14, the HDD encrypted firmwares programming instruction that user sends at the DOS interfaces is received, by the USB storage device
In redaction HDD encrypted firmwares programming to the electronic equipment.
HDD encrypted firmwares update method provided in an embodiment of the present invention, HDD encrypted firmware programming work(is opened at BIOS interfaces
And redaction HDD encrypted firmware programmings can be completed at DOS interfaces, compared with prior art, easy to operate, renewal speed is fast, no
The USB port for needing again to use the renewal of HDD encrypted firmwares configures, it is possible to increase the operating efficiency of HDD encrypted firmwares renewal.
Alternatively, as shown in Fig. 2 on the basis of the HDD encrypted firmwares update method shown in Fig. 1, methods described
It is further comprising the steps of:
S15, the redaction HDD encrypted firmwares programming by the USB storage device to the electronic equipment it
Afterwards, the electronic equipment is restarted, the electronic equipment receives the BIOS enabled instructions that user sends, into BIOS interfaces;
S16, at the BIOS interfaces, the electronic equipment judges whether the HDD encrypted firmwares are updated successfully, if renewal
Success, prompt user to be updated successfully, otherwise prompt user that renewal is unsuccessful.
Alternatively, after the electronic device prompts user is updated successfully, methods described is further comprising the steps of:
S17, the HDD encrypted firmware programming function out codes that user sends are received, close the HDD encrypted firmwares programming
Function;
S18, the shutdown command that user sends is received, close the electronic equipment.
Alternatively, it is necessary to carry out programming again after electronic device prompts user renewal is unsuccessful.Restart described
Electronic equipment, S13~S16 is performed, until the electronic device prompts user is updated successfully, execution S17, S18, completion is entirely
HDD encrypted firmware renewal processes.
Alternatively, the electronic equipment after the BIOS enabled instructions that send of user are received, it is necessary to input specific power
Password is limited, the web-privilege password Web is different from common user cipher, and after web-privilege password Web checking is correct, user could enter BIOS circle
Face.
Alternatively, the electronic equipment after the DOS enabled instructions that send of user are received, it is necessary to input specific authority
Password, the web-privilege password Web can be identical with the web-privilege password Web for entering BIOS interfaces, but is different from common user cipher, and authority is close
After code checking is correct, user could enter DOS interfaces.
